CEO, Chairman of the Board and Independent Directors selected for
VimpelCom Ltd.
(Fornebu/Norway and Moscow/Russia - 30 November 2009) Telenor and
Altimo have agreed to appoint Alexander Izosimov as the CEO of
VimpelCom Ltd. Jo Lunder will be the Chairman of the Board of
Directors. Mr. Lunder, Mr. Leonid Novoselsky and Dr. Hans Peter
Kohlhammer will be the independent members of VimpelCom Ltd.'s Board
of Directors.
On 5 October 2009, Telenor ASA and Altimo Holdings & Investments Ltd.
announced their agreement to combine their common assets in Ukrainian
mobile operator Kyivstar and Russian mobile operator OJSC VimpelCom
in a newly formed Bermuda company, VimpelCom Ltd., which will be
headquartered in the Netherlands. Today, Telenor and Altimo announce
that they have selected candidates to fill VimpelCom Ltd.'s
leadership positions: Alexander V. Izosimov, presently non-executive
President of OJSC VimpelCom, will be appointed as VimpelCom Ltd.'s
President and CEO, and Jo Lunder will become an independent director
and Chairman of VimpelCom Ltd.'s Board. Leonid Novoselsky and Dr.
Hans Peter Kohlhammer will become independent members of VimpelCom
Ltd.'s Board of Directors.

Chairman of the Board
Jo Lunder is currently the Executive Vice President of FERD, one of
Norway's largest privately-owned financial and industrial groups.
Previously, Mr. Lunder served as the Chief Executive Officer of Atea
ASA, one of Europe's largest IT-infrastructure companies listed on
the Oslo Stock Exchange. Prior to that, he served as Managing
Director of Telenor Privat and Vice Managing Director of Telenor
Mobil. Mr Lunder has been a member of the OJSC VimpelCom Board of
Directors since May 2002. During his tenure at OJSC VimpelCom, Mr.
Lunder served as Chairman of the Board, Chief Executive Officer, and
Chief Operating Officer. In addition, Mr. Lunder currently serves as
Chairman of the Aibel Group of Companies, the second largest Nordic
oil and gas services company, Chairman of Elopak AS, the world's
third largest liquid carton packaging company, and Chairman of Swix
Sport AS, a global supplier of winter clothing and skiing equipment.
Mr. Lunder earned a B.A. degree from Oslo Business School and holds
an MBA from Henley Management College (UK). Mr. Lunder is 48 years
old and is a Norwegian citizen.
President and CEO
Alexander Izosimov served as OJSC VimpelCom's Chief Executive Officer
and General Director from October 2003 until April 2009. Mr. Izosimov
currently is the Chairman of the Board of GSM Association and serves
on the Boards of Directors of Baltika Breweries Plc., MTG AB and
Dynasty Foundation. Mr. Izosimov also is a member of the Council on
Competitiveness and Entrepreneurship in Russia. Prior to joining OJSC
VimpelCom, Mr. Izosimov held senior positions with Mars, Inc. [in
Moscow] and McKinsey & Company in Stockholm and London. Mr. Izosimov
has a M.S. degree from the Moscow Aviation Institute and an MBA from
INSEAD. Mr. Izosimov is 46 years old, and is a Russian citizen.
Independent Directors
VimpelCom Ltd.'s Board will consist of nine directors, three of whom
will be appointed by each of Telenor and Alfa and three of whom will
be independent. In addition to Mr. Lunder, the VimpelCom Ltd.'s
independent directors will consist of the following people:
Leonid Novoselsky
Leonid Novoselsky has been a director of OJSC VimpelCom since June
2006. He is a co-founder and the General Director of the Gradient
Group. Mr. Novoselsky also has served as General Director of LLC
"Arbat Prestige Gradient" since 2005 and a founding member of LLC
"Trade House "Symposium" since 2007. From September 2008, Mr.
Novoselsky has served as a director of OJSC "Protec", one of the
largest pharmaceutical distributors in Russia. Mr. Novoselsky
graduated from the Moscow Institute of Steel and Alloys and has an
MBA from the University of Pennsylvania Wharton Business School. Mr.
Novoselsky is 39 years old, and is a Russian citizen.
Dr. Hans Peter Kohlhammer
Hans Peter Kohlhammer has been a director of OJSC VimpelCom since
June 2008. Dr. Kohlhammer has been the Chief Executive Officer of
Kohlhammer Consulting since August 2006 and served as the Chief
Executive Officer of Broadnet AG in Hamburg from December 2006 to
October 2007. From 2003 to 2006, Dr. Kohlhammer was the Chief
Executive Officer and Director General of the telecom company SITA SC
in Geneva. From 2001 until 2003, Dr. Kohlhammer was the President
and Chief Executive Officer of Grundig AG. Dr. Kohlhammer has a Ph.D.
degree in Mathematics from Bonn University. Dr. Kohlhammer is 62
years old, and is a German citizen.

Background
VimpelCom Ltd. will be a leading mobile operator in Russia, Ukraine
and the CIS, with a significant presence in Southeast Asia. VimpelCom
Ltd. will seek to expand its operations in other rapidly developing
markets in Europe, Asia and Africa, becoming one of the world's
leading players in the industry. VimpelCom Ltd. is incorporated in
Bermuda and will be headquartered in the Netherlands and listed on
the NYSE.
Subject to receiving the required regulatory and other approvals,
VimpelCom Ltd. intends to make an offer whereby OJSC VimpelCom shares
and ADRs will be exchanged for Depositary Receipts ("DRs")
representing shares in VimpelCom Ltd. (the "Exchange Offer").
Immediately following the successful completion of the Exchange
Offer, Telenor and Altimo will contribute their respective
shareholdings in Kyivstar in exchange for shares in VimpelCom Ltd.
The parties expect to complete the proposed Exchange Offer and the
other related transactions by mid-2010, following which VimpelCom
Ltd. intends to delist OSJC VimpelCom's securities from the New York
Stock Exchange and the Russian Trading System.
The Telenor Group is an international provider of high quality
telephony, data and media communication services with mobile
operations in 13 markets across the Nordic region, Central and
Eastern Europe and in Asia. Headquartered in Norway, the Telenor
Group is among the largest mobile operators in the world with over
160 million mobile subscriptions, revenues in 2008 of NOK 110
billion, and a workforce of more than 40,000.
Altimo specializes in telecoms investments in Russia, the CIS and
Asia. Its stakes include: 44% of the voting interest in VimpelCom,
one of Russia's two biggest mobile phone companies (NYSE: VIP); 25.1%
of MegaFon, the third largest GSM provider in Russia; 43.5% of
Kyivstar, Ukraine's largest mobile phone company; and 4.99% of
Turkcell, Turkey's largest mobile company (NYSE: TKC). Together,
Altimo's investee companies serve more than 160 million mobile phone
subscribers.
